论Delphi开发商品化软件的优点
计算机与信息技术论文1995年10月,当我们在考虑选择哪种开发工具来开发新的Windows版本企业管理软件时,有很多意见:VC2.0,BC4.5,VB4.0,PB4.0,Foxpro2.5forWindows和DelphiC/S。由于以前我们的全部DOS和Windows产品全是由BorlandC编写的,彻底感觉过C编写大型应用软件的优点和缺点---能解决所有新问题但投入代价太高!所以我们决定抛弃C,另外选择。为郑重起见,我和几个主力开发人员一起测试了其余的开发工具,最后几乎全部决定采用一个很新的工具Delphi1.0C/S,当时考虑的因素如下:1.Delphi是唯一真正的编译语言。由于大型通用软件的速度要求较高,经验和测试表明PB,VB,Foxpro编写的大程序较慢,Delphi的程序开发和运行时都很快。2.DelphiC/S支持单机的dBase,Paradox数据库和流行的关系数据库,如Oracle,Sybase,MSSQLServer等。这样,最后的系统可以在单机、Netware网络文件共享方式和C/S条件下运行,扩大了企业使用范围。3.Delphi的Pascal语言是和C是几乎相同的面向对象语言,非常好,习惯了COO编程的高级C程序员很轻易接受。而且,Borland的Pascal一直非常好。4.DelphiC/S有全部构件的Source,可以在需要的时候修改和增加构件。现在,我们完成了一套庞大的产品"天心企业全能管理系统",是一套包含企业的财务管理、仓库管理、销售管理、应收应付帐款管理、报表系统、成本核算、生产管理、商场POS前后台业务处理、工资考勤管理和结合Internet/Intranet的公文管理、报表查询的完整系统。它是32位的应用,运行于英文和简体、繁体Windows95/NT上,后台支持各种数据库连接,包括NT、95